Answer:
The volume of the prism increased by a factor of 64.
Explanation:
Given that the original prism and the increased prism are similar, we have that the scale factor is:
Area ∝ (length of side) x (length of side)
If the area increases by a factor of 16, each side increases by a scale factor of √16 = 4. Regarding the volume:
Volume ∝ (length of side) x (length of side) x (length of side)
Thus the increase factor for the volume, in this case, is 4 x 4 x 4 = 64.
